Valldemossa rewards visitors who plan slightly ahead. The village is tiny and has no vet of its own, the nearest day clinic is 7 km away in Esporles and the nearest 24h hospital is 17 km away in Palma. The Real Cartuja monastery, the village's main draw, accepts leashed dogs in its outdoor cloister and gardens but not inside the museum cells, verify the day's policy at the entrance. The Serra de Tramuntana is a UNESCO Cultural Landscape with strict leash rules due to sheep grazing. Mallorca's seasonal beach ban applies at Cala Valldemossa from April 1 to October 31. The compulsory pet insurance for dogs in the Balearic Islands (since September 2023) catches many visitors out, check before flying.
